The average cost of a 25kW commercial solar system ranges from $50,000 to $70,000 before incentives or rebates. Factors such as location, quality of panels, and installation complexity significantly affect the total cost. Maintenance requirements for high-efficiency commercial solar systems are. . Solar panels cover the roof of facilities inaugurated in 2024 at APM Terminals' West Africa Container Terminal in Onne, Nigeria. Over 40 ports - including in Aqaba (Jordan), Suape (Brazil), and Abidjan (Côte d'Ivoire) - are deploying electric container handling equipment, nvesting in clean energy, and digitising logistics systems.

This device is usually composed of a standard-sized container equipped with photovoltaic modules. . By using a plug & play containerized plant, launching and interconnecting, as well as scaling, becomes very simple. You are able to avoid the paperwork of building permits and can easily move, add or even replace containers in your project.
